Craniosacral therapy is exactly as gentle as it sounds. Using touch lighter than the weight of a nickel, Dr. Hannah works with the subtle rhythms of the central nervous system to support regulation, calm, and healing.
It's some of the most quietly powerful work in our practice. Newborns who weren't latching find their way. Highly sensitive kids exhale for the first time in a week. Adults processing trauma feel their nervous systems shift in real time.
It looks like very little is happening — and that's the point. The work is being done by the body itself, under the safety of a skilled, listening touch.
What to expect
- A quiet, dimly lit room. Clothes stay on.
- Gentle, sustained holds at the head, sacrum, and along the spine.
- Long pauses. Often, deep relaxation or even sleep.
- Time afterward to integrate before you head back into the world.
Who this is for
- Newborns with feeding, sleep, or birth-recovery needs
- Sensitive kids and anxious sleepers
- Adults healing from trauma, concussion, or burnout
- Anyone who finds traditional bodywork too intense
